The world is facing severe problems of energy crisis and environmental problem. This situation makes people to focus their attention on sustainable energy resources for their survival. Biomass is recognized to be the major potential source for energy production. There are ranges of biomass utilization technologies that produce useful energy from biomass. Partial combustion of biomass in the gasifier generates producer gas that can be used for heating purposes and as supplementary or sole fuel in internal combustion engines. Gasification is one of the promising technologies to convert biomass to gaseous fuels for distributed power generation. In this study the performance of the gasifier–engine system is analyzed by running the engine for various producer gas– air flow ratios and at different load conditions. |
